Modern Slavery Compliance Toolkit
Structured within PDCA Framework
Modern Slavery Compliance Toolkit designed around the PDCA (Plan–Do–Check–Act) framework to operationalise modern slavery governance across your supply chain.
-
Aligned to the Australian Modern Slavery Act 2018 s.16 mandatory criteria with explicit mapping across all key tabs and question sets.
-
Integrates with ISO 9001, ISO 14001 and ISO 45001 clauses so quality, environmental, OH&S and modern slavery controls are managed in a single coherent system.
-
PLAN worksheets for countries of operation, sectors and source countries, auto-classifying risk tiers using US TIP and ILAB indicators and pre‑assigned inherent risk ratings.
-
Supplier Modern Slavery Self‑Assessment (28 questions) aligned to STRT v3.2, MSA s.16 and relevant ISO clauses with auto-scoring, risk flags and gap visibility.
-
Central Risk Register structured for modern slavery threats in own operations, tier 1 and deeper supply chain, labour recruiters and worker protections with likelihood–consequence scoring.
-
Corrective & Preventive Action Tracker linked to risk items and supplier reviews, including owner, due date, priority and status, ready for audit trail and Board reporting.
-
Modern Slavery Compliance Dashboard showing live KPIs, supplier completion status, risk ratings, PDCA phase status and MSA s.16 portfolio compliance snapshot.
-
Pre‑structured for SharePoint and Power BI: named tables (Supplier Review, Risk Register, Action Tracker, Country Data, Sector Data) are ready for direct import into a live reporting environment.
-
Clear Instructions sheet with legend, navigation, responsibilities and PDCA / MSA / ISO mapping so users can deploy the toolkit rapidly without rebuilding structure. Designed for cross‑functional use by compliance, procurement, HR, legal and operations, with supplier‑facing fields that support evidence capture, links and document references.
-
Supports continual improvement cycles by tying supplier responses to risks, actions and effectiveness reviews in line with ISO clause 10 requirements.
